To fill out the 2020 tax rate calculation, follow these steps:
02
Gather all your relevant financial documents, including W-2s, 1099s, and other income documents.
03
Determine your filing status (single, married filing jointly, etc.) and gather any necessary information pertaining to your filing status.
04
Calculate your total income for the tax year by adding up all your sources of income, including wages, self-employment income, and investment income.
05
Calculate your adjusted gross income (AGI) by subtracting any deductions or adjustments you are eligible for from your total income.
06
Determine your taxable income by subtracting any applicable exemptions and deductions from your AGI.
07
Use the tax rate schedules provided by the Internal Revenue Service (IRS) to determine your tax liability based on your taxable income.
08
Consider any tax credits you may be eligible for and reduce your tax liability accordingly.
09
Complete any necessary forms and schedules, such as Form 1040 or Schedule A, to accurately report your income, deductions, and credits.
10
Double-check all your calculations and make sure you have included all necessary information.
11
File your completed tax rate calculation along with your tax return by the deadline specified by the IRS.
12
Remember to consult with a tax professional or utilize tax preparation software if you need assistance or have complex tax situations.

The tax rate calculation worksheet is a form used to determine the applicable tax rates for various jurisdictions, including local, state, and federal taxes.
Individuals and businesses that are required to report their tax rates to the government, including municipalities and counties, are generally required to file the tax rate calculation worksheet.
To fill out the tax rate calculation worksheet, gather relevant financial data, complete each section of the form with accurate numbers, and ensure that all calculations follow the guidelines provided by the tax authority.
The purpose of the tax rate calculation worksheet is to accurately calculate and report tax rates to ensure compliance with tax laws and to provide transparency in the funding of public services.
Information that must be reported includes property tax assessments, prior year tax rates, current year budget figures, and any exemptions or deductions applicable.
